G.Skill Unveils Trident X Series DDR3-2400 MHz Modular-Heatsink Overclocking Memory

G.Skill unveiled its newest line of memory for extreme overclocking, the Trident X. Its launch is timed to follow that of Intel's Core "Ivy Bridge" processor family, and is optimized for 7-series chipset motherboards (due to their support of latest Intel XMP 1.3 specification). Pictured below is what Trident X series modules look like: a black PCB with a slightly long black metal heatsink, which has a detachable crown heatsink (red). One can notice a slot for heat pipes in the juncture between the crown heatsink and the module's main heatsink.

Aesthetically, the Trident X series modules don a black+red color scheme, which goes well with the black+red motherboard in the background (in the press-shot). Pictured below are the DDR3-2400 MHz (PC3-19200) modules in dual-channel configuration. The XMP profile runs the module at its 2400 MHz DDR (1200 MHz real) speed, with timings of 10-12-12-31T, and DRAM voltage of 1.65V. The modules will be available in various other speed/timing configurations, and in densities of 4 GB and 8 GB, making up for 8 GB and 16 GB dual-channel kits, for the new "Ivy Bridge" platform; 16 GB and 32 GB quad-channel kits for the Sandy Bridge-E platform. The older Sandy Bridge LGA1155 platform might not be 100% compatible, since it lacks XMP 1.3 support. G.Skill Trident X will be formally announced on May 4.

MSI Launches GeForce GTX 680 Twin Frozr III OC Graphics Card

Leading international graphics card maker MSI today officially announced the new GTX 680 Twin Frozr /OC graphics card equipped with the latest NVIDIA 28nm GeForce GTX 680 GPU, 2GB video memory and PCI Express Gen3 support. The new GTX 680 Twin Frozr /OC sports the popular Twin Frozr III thermal design, featuring dual 80mm Propeller Blade fans, a nickel-plated copper base heat sink and SuperPipe technology. MSI's GTX 680 Twin Frozr /OC has 22°C lower temperatures and runs 10.2dB quieter than the reference design, providing the perfect balance of low-noise and great cooling capabilities.

In addition the GTX 680 Twin Frozr /OC also supports MSI's Afterburner overclocking utility, which enables you to tweak power and clock settings to get even more performance out of your graphics card. Both NVIDIA 3D Vision Surround and 4 display out from a single card are supported ensuring that gamers can enjoy the best entertainment and multitasking experience possible.

MSI MOA 2012 "STEEL WORLD" Kicks off in Americas

Celebrating its 5th anniversary, MSI's Master Overclocking Arena (MOA) joins the most stable Military Class III components with record-breaking overclocking performance. Themed "Steel World", MSI has forged the first evolution starting with the American Regional Qualifiers on the world-class overclocking community website HWBOT.org on April 13, 2012.

The American Regional Qualifiers this year consist of three stages: 3DMark11, 3DMark03 and SuperPI 32M. Each with a different point scheme. There will be no model limitation on MSI mainboards and graphics cards, however entries are limited to single CPU and GPU setups. A cut-off elimination will be applied on May 4th (75% of the contest period) after which the qualifiers will continue with only the best 15 overall participants.

MSI Announces Next Generation R7970 Lightning Graphics Card

Leading international graphics card and mainboard maker MSI today announced the release of the MSI R7970 Lightning, the new heir to the throne of Lightning graphics cards. Equipped with AMD's 28 nm Radeon HD 7970 GPU, the MSI R7970 Lightning features an all-new Unlocked Digital Power Architecture that incorporates an Unlocked BIOS, Digital PWM Controller, and Enhanced Power Design to boost overclocking potential to new heights and make overclocking easier than ever.

In an industry first, the proprietary "GPU Reactor" power supply module reduces power supply noise and also boosts overclocking stability as well. To keep this beast cool, the MSI R7970 Lightning utilizes the latest Twin Frozr IV Thermal Design equipped with Dust Removal Technology. The dual 10 cm fans with Propeller Blade Technology generate massive airflow for fast heat dissipation while remaining whisper silent. The two form-in-one heat sinks improve cooling for memory and the power supply module as well ensure structural integrity.

Sandy Bridge-E Stock Watercooling: Enthusiast Overclocking Right Out Of The Box

Intel have finally confirmed that they will be including water cooling as an enthusiast solution for their upcoming Core i7-3000 series Sandy Bridge-E processors due for release on November 14 - a first for Intel and something for AMD to match. They have gone with Asetek due to their high quality products and good reputation, which will be branded with the distinctive Intel blue logos. The 12cm radiator fan will actually be illuminated in Intel Blue, giving a classy look to the kit. On top of that, they will actually sell the kit separately, so no one need feel left out. The E-series chips are already significantly faster than the current Sandy Bridge offerings, but water cooling will be able to stretch that lead even further and should make for some exciting overclocking achievements. Perhaps 6GHz or more 24/7 reliable operation is within reach? No prices as yet.

MSI Overclocking Competition Won By the Favourites, Real Money Handed Out As Prize

Well, this is good news for PC enthusiasts. PC overclocking has become a competitive sport in recent years with various brands hosting the competitions and others also chipping in with sponsorship money. This year's event was the fourth annual MSI Master Overclocking Arena competition held in Taipei, Taiwan, with sponsorship money coming from the likes of Intel and Kingston among others. Basic competition info: sixteen teams worldwide; benchmarks used were Super PI 32M, 3DMark 11 and surprisingly, the ancient 3DMark 2001SE but it's not clear why such an old benchmark is being used; the components used are given to contestants based on a lottery system, the team picking a number corresponding to either a CPU or a complete rig. This prevents contestants from having an unfair advantage by bringing in their own heavily modified kit to press home an advantage. Imagine how much more potent a modded motherboard with beefed up voltage regulators could be? Turned out that the favourites, previous winners Romania, won the competition. The prize money was only $3000, which is paltry compared to mainstream sports, but remember that this overclocking "sport" is still very new and is very niche in nature, so isn't so unreasonable when viewed in that light. AMD's Bulldozer 8.4GHz+ OC Achievement: Cooled to Near-Absolute Zero

AMD's Bulldozer 8.4 GHz+ OC Achievement: Cooled to Near-Absolute Zero

TechPowerUp recently brought you news on AMDs fantastic overclocking achievement with their new processors. Now we can tell you how it was done: cherry-picking the chips and slapping on some water cooling isn't quite enough. AMDs new processors can operate at much lower temperatures without displaying the "cold bug" - where it just gives up and goes home - and performance scales very well at super-low temperatures. The problem is that the cold affects lots of things such as timing, but more importantly, power circuits, which stop switching and just fry everything in sight - surely one to avoid. AMD senior manager of social media, Simon Solotko explains in detail how it was all done, using both liquid helium and liquid nitrogen to make the poor processor really cold. The new processor had these great qualities, according to Solotko:
It was able to take a lot of voltage, extremely low temperatures, extremely high frequencies," he said. "It was very durable under extreme overclocking. So that was awesome. So it worked well, it scaled well, it responded to cold well - all the right variables.
This overclock is an impressive feat and it will be interesting to see if Intel can match it.

A8-3850 Has Ineffective BClk Multiplier

"Empty Overclocking" is a term we just made up, to describe unreal overclocking headroom that does not translate into any performance improvements, with AMD's A8-3850 APU. This chip can be set to run at base clock multiplier value above 29x on some motherboards, that will increase clock speed being reported to you, but that "increased" clock speed will not translate to any performance improvements at all.

This means that the multiplier is ineffective in driving the clock above its maximum default value. So the next time you see screenshots screaming something like "6.00 GHz" on air with the base clock at its default 100 MHz, don't be fooled, trust only those overclocking feats in which the multiplier is set at the maximum default (29.0x) or lesser, and in which the overclocker has increased the base clock among other things.

Update: It seems like AMD is aware of the issue, and forewarned reviewers about it. Apparently a glitch in the BIOS code allows the users to "set" higher multiplier values than the chip can respond to, even as the chip doesn't run at those values. Utilities like CPU-Z read those BIOS-set values and display the effective clock speed, even as the actual clock speed doesn't budge. AMD recommends only the base clock increase method for overclocking. As always, AMD warned that overclocked chips are not covered by product warranties. Perhaps future BIOS updates by motherboard vendors will fix this bug.

Apacer Announces ARES DDR3-2133 MHz Dual Channel Memory Kits for Overclocking

Apacer, one of the world's leading brands of memory modules, today announced an expansion of its ARES overclocking memory series with high capacity and clock rate: DDR3-2133 8GB (4GBx2) dual channel memory kit,which is engineered for the latest Intel P67 and Z68 Sandy Bridge platforms. With a combination of high clock rate, huge capacity and low latency of CL9, ARES series is a perfect solution for extreme PC enthusiasts and gamers who want to optimize performance on the new platforms.

The newly-unveiled ARES DDR3-2133 8GB dual channel memory kit provides the highspeed and capacityon the Intel P67 and Z68 Sandy Bridge platforms and is backwards compatible with existing the P55 platform. It runs at CL9-11-9-27 with 1.65 voltage, using advancedprocess 256Mb x 8chips, which are screened and tested withthe advanced test fixture and programs under diversified parameters of voltage and time sequences.

ColorFire Readies Radeon HD 6870 Graphics Card for Extreme Overclocking

ColorFire, the associate brand of Colorful that specializes in AMD Radeon-based graphics cards, today released a new Radeon HD 6870 card geared for extreme overclocking. Its design revolves around high-grade VRM, powerful cooling, and dual BIOS, each packing overclocked settings. The ColorFire Xstorm HD 6870 is a completely non-reference design card, the GPU is powered by a 5+1 phase VRM that uses POSCAP capacitors. The card uses two BIOS ROM chips that can be selected using a push-switch on the rear panel. The "normal" BIOS packs clock speeds of 940 MHz core and 1100 MHz (4.40 GHz effective) memory, while the "turbo" BIOS runs the card at 1050 MHz core, 1150 MHz (4.60 GHz effective) memory.

The card is cooled by a large custom-design cooler the company earlier used on an HD 6850 card with similar design. It uses a large heat pipe-fed heatsink that is cooled by a 110 mm fan. Other overclocker-friendly features include consolidated voltage measure points with cables; and hardware-based voltage adjustment using DIP switches on the card. It draws power from two 6-pint power connectors. Display outputs include two DVI, and one each of full-size HDMI 1.4a, and DisplayPort 1.2. Colorfire will first sell the card in Asia, and then in Europe.

Heads Roll in Lords of Overclocking Competition Cheating Scandal

Over the last week, the enthusiast community witnessed high drama as some world-renowned overclockers were disqualified from the MSI Lords of Overclocking online competition for engaging in malpractice. Futuremark noticed that some validation entries from top scoring candidates originated from the same setup, confirmed from consistency in Futuremark product key and PCI devices. Top three position-holders at the LoOC competition admitted to using scores generated by a third person, AndreYang. Hiwa, eXtremetweaker.de, KJ and Skinnee were named as disqualified candidates.

What happened next could come as a surprise to some. Major overclocking communities banned these individuals, some permanently, with enthusiast charts aggregator HWBOT handing out a 1 year ban to each of them (although HWBOT wasn't involved in that competition), and XtremeSystems.org issuing lifetime bans. Even as some question the motives behind Andre sharing scores with four people at the same time, the candidates deny that Andre had any intention to profit from it, other than just helping.

NVIDIA Releases GeForce 196.34 BETA Drivers, Corrects Overclocking Issue

NVIDIA today let loose of GeForce 196.34 beta driver suite. The beta release comes after the recently-released GeForce 196.21 WHQL drivers, and corrects a severe bug which prevents GPU overclocking. It retains the rest of the feature-set of its WHQL predecessor. Being a beta release, its use is unsupported by NVIDIA, though a WHQL-signed version can be expected soon.

The GeForce 196.34 beta driver suite provides system software for NVIDIA GeForce desktop and mobile graphics processors, NVIDIA ION platform, along with Graphics Plus components such as CUDA, PhysX, 3D Vision, etc.
